Carolyn Yucha, CHHS

Dr. Carolyn Yucha, pronounced “Yu-ha,” has been appointed as the Interim Dean of the College of Health and Human Sciences, effective August 31. Dr. Yucha will serve in this role for a one-year appointment, providing continuity and stability for the college as we conduct a national search for its next permanent dean.

SJSU Student Research Day Showcases Student Projects Across Multiple Disciplines

At the 21st annual Student Research Day, around 250 College of Science students shared discoveries spanning everything from quantum states to astrobiology. Founded by longtime SJSU chemistry professor Roy Okuda, the event has grown from 36 posters in 2005 into one of the university’s largest celebrations of student research.
